Warning Signs You Need Kitchen Water Damage Restoration in Germantown, WI
Catching these signs early can prevent costly repairs and even compromise the integrity of your home. Here are some warning signs you need kitchen water damage restoration: Don’t ignore these signs.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ell in your kitchen, it may be a sign of hidden water damage. Don’t ignore this sign, as it can lead to mold growth and further damage. Get it checked out.
Warped or Discolored Flooring
If your kitchen flooring is warped or discolored, it may be a sign of water damage. This can be caused by a leaky pipe or a clogged drain. Get it inspected.
Water Stains on Ceilings and Walls
Water stains on your kitchen ceiling or walls can be a sign of a leaky pipe or a clogged drain. Don’t ignore this sign, as it can lead to further damage and even compromise the integrity of your home. Get it fixed.

Kitchen Water Damage Restoration Cost in Germantown, WI
The cost of kitchen water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Germantown, WI. Here’s a breakdown of typical price ranges for different services: We’ll work with you to create a customized plan that meets your needs and budget.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, equipment rental fees |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of cleaning products used |
| Repair and re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ials used |
| Inspection and testing |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ment used |
| Documenting damage for insurance purposes |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of documentation required |
The final cost of kitchen water damage restoration will depend on the specifics of your situation and the customized plan we create for you.
